Output d570ab26fcd372afb09a554a187b5cd42123f5fd149e093551ead24384f881b4:11

value
63352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6dea89f81823413e1e26d775d9a864b8c2550b OP_EQUAL
address
3QtKENsWzRyeukppdqsoP4LjfH9iJUfB46
transaction
d570ab26fcd372afb09a554a187b5cd42123f5fd149e093551ead24384f881b4
spent
true